方法1:使用 git merge 首先,确保你在new-branch上: git checkout new-branch 然后,使用git merge命令将other-branch上的更改合并到new-branch上: git merge other-branch 这样,other-branch上的所有提交都会被合并到new-branch上。 【注】若使用smartgit工具,则直接通过merge 按钮,选择需要merge的提交,再通过commit...
15.分支创建与合并1、右击一个项目:team/switch to/new branch:(这样就把本地branch和本地的working directory联系起来了(本地branch上出现个小黑钩,而master还照样存在),working directory的项目始终是一个。 更多内容请见原文
git merge branch 命令是用来将指定分支的代码合并到当前分支的命令。它使用 fast-forward 合并和三方合并策略来合并分支的修改内容。合并过程中可能会发生冲突,需要手动解决冲突。合并会在提交历史中创建一个新的提交记录,并且可以使用 git reset 命令进行合并的回滚操作。 Git是现今最流行的版本控制系统之一,它提供了...
See git-config[1]. Everything above this line in this section isn’t included from the git-config[1] documentation. The content that follows is the same as what’s found there: branch.autoSetupMerge Tells git branch, git switch and git checkout to set up new branches so that git-...
git pull origin branch1 (也可以分步执行) git fetch origin branch1 git merge branch1 如果出现 conflict 点开左边第三个 source control 把文件一个个点开去解决冲突就好,HEAD是当前的master,保留当前就选 Accept Current Change 每修好一个文件,可以点击 + 号,把文件 stage 到 changes 里,最后统一 commit...
$ git merge feature Auto-merging file.txt CONFLICT (content): Merge conflict in file.txt Automatic merge failed; fix conflicts and then commit the result. “` 在上面的例子中,由于合并过程中出现冲突,GIT 会提示合并失败,并告知我们需要手动解决冲突。冲突的文件会被标记为“冲突”,我们需要打开这些文件...
Git当中如何分支(Branch)创建与合并(Merge) 15.分支创建与合并 1、右击一个项目:team/switch to/new branch:(这样就把本地branch和本地的working directory联系起来了(本地branch上出现个小黑钩,而master还照样存在),working directory的项目始终是一个。
首先,我们先来理解一下merge命令的原理,下图说明了merge命令执行前后,git分支的变化情况 首先,红色d...
在GitLib 的 Web 界面中选择 Merge Requests 然后再界面中选择新建一个 Merge Request。 在左侧选择需要合并的 Branch,在右侧选择合并到的 Branch, 选择完成后单击按钮比较 branch 并且合并。 在弹出的界面中,单击提交合并按钮来进行合并 随后将会显示合并的按钮来进行合并,你需要单击这个按钮,否则的话是没有办法进行...
Merge Branches To merge any branches: From within your Git repository folder, right-click the white space of the Current Folder browser and selectSource ControlandBranches. In the Branches dialog box, from theBranchesdrop-down list, select a branch you want to merge into the current branch, an...